Abstract
Solow neoclassical growth theory considers technological progress as exogenous, but the shortcoming is the theory doesn't reflect correctly the correlation between economic growth and technological progress. On the contrary, New Growth Theory, typically represented by Romer's RD model and Lucas's human capital model, takes account of technological progress and human capital accumulation as endogenous, but its shortcoming is to take saving rate and population growth rate as exogenous. Analysing the correlation between economic growth and saving rate and population growth rate, this paper takes saving rate and population growth rate as endogenous and analyses the law of economic growth.
